The correlation between TIPX and TIPZ is 0.04,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

TIPX vs. TIPZ - Expense Ratio Comparison

TIPX has a 0.15% expense ratio, which is lower than TIPZ's 0.20% expense ratio. Despite the difference, both funds are considered low-cost compared to the broader market, where average expense ratios usually range from 0.3% to 0.9%.

TIPX vs. TIPZ - Drawdown Comparison

The maximum TIPX drawdown since its inception was -10.06%, smaller than the maximum TIPZ drawdown of -15.41%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for TIPX and TIPZ. For additional features, visit the drawdowns tool.

TIPX vs. TIPZ -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for SPDR Bloomberg Barclays 1-10 Year TIPS ETF (TIPX) is 1.31%, while PIMCO Broad US TIPS Index ETF (TIPZ) has a volatility of 1.56%. This indicates that TIPX exper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than TIPZ based on this measure.
